Frequently asked

What is the source of their powers?
Both Shazam and Black Adam draw their powers from magic lightning, granted by the gods.
How do their backgrounds differ?
Shazam is a modern hero from a contemporary background, while Black Adam hails from ancient Egypt, bringing a distinct cultural perspective to the table.
What drives their actions?
Shazam is driven by a desire to do good and protect the innocent, while Black Adam is motivated by a strong sense of justice and a need to protect his nation at any cost.
